Chitravadi, Nandod

Chitravadi is a village and Gram Panchayat of the Nandod Taluk in Narmada district of Gujarat, which falls under Nandod block. It belongs to Chhota Udaipur parliament constituency and Nandod assembly constituency. As on May 2024, the current population of Chitravadi is 822 out of which 445 are males and rest 377 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 847 females per 1000 males. There are around 82 teenagers in Chitravadi. It has literacy rate of 68% which means around 556 persons can read and write. Total 41 people belonging to scheduled caste and 660 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 187 households in Chitravadi, which means every family has 4 members on average.
